Cornish and Cornish v Brelade Bay Limited [2018] JRC 153 (28 August 2018)
The caveat was set aside due to material non-disclosure by the Applicants regarding the latent defects insurance policy, prior compensation for delay, and outstanding sums owed to the Respondent. The urgency and necessity for the caveat were not established, and alternative security measures were not explored. The balance of convenience did not justify re-imposing the caveat, especially given the disproportion between the claim and the value of the property affected.
